Transaction 51e95060f72b33c0b79cd19cc7a5e20d2136ae53d3691d661a5c2770c30bf235
1 Input
1 Output
-
51e95060f72b33c0b79cd19cc7a5e20d2136ae53d3691d661a5c2770c30bf235:0
- value
- 2050800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 47e5c8992c58a38c07eeb220789cd7e4ca95c9f3 OP_EQUAL
- address
- 38FBAomr6gK4WZsErdEvTMYiPvTFQF5QUJ